New Tata Nexon: BUY For Looks, Powertrains, And Good Features

Tata Nexon

The Tata Nexon was not too long ago launched in a facelifted avatar, which gave it a sharper design language and a better-looking cabin. While it continued with each the petrol and diesel engines because the pre-facelift mannequin, Tata now even provides a 7-speed DCT possibility within the combine. Not solely that, the sub-4m SUV additionally acquired many new options together with a much bigger 10.25-inch touchscreen system, a ten.25-inch digital driver’s show, a 360-degree digicam and 6 airbags as customary. That mentioned, the Nexon falls behind the 2024 Sonet in the case of newest security tech and high quality points.

Hyundai Venue: BUY For A Similar Package With The Hyundai Badge

Hyundai Venue

If you consider premium SUVs within the sub-4m class, it’s seemingly that your decide might be both the Kia Sonet or the Hyundai Venue. Both SUVs are primarily based on the identical platform and provide a really comparable expertise, be it when it comes to powertrains or characteristic set. The Venue will get nearly the identical engine-gearbox combos because the Sonet (save for the diesel-auto) however misses out on just a few options together with a 360-degree digicam, ventilated seats, and greater 10.25-inch shows.

Maruti Brezza: BUY For Space, A Larger Petrol Engine And A Wide Service Network

Maruti Brezza

One of the preferred names within the sub-4m SUV area has been the Maruti Brezza. The second-generation of the SUV was launched in 2022 and it’s extra spacious than the Kia Sonet. It has a pair extra benefits over the Kia SUV within the type of a bigger (however not punchy) 1.5-litre petrol engine possibility and Maruti’s pan-India service community. That mentioned, the Brezza lacks within the high quality division, options on provide and even the choice of a diesel engine.

Maruti Fronx: BUY For Looks And A Potent Turbo Engine

Maruti Fronx

In 2023, Maruti launched a Baleno-based crossover sub-4m SUV named the ‘Fronx.’ The Maruti Fronx serves as a extra stylised various to the boxy Brezza. It is an SUV-coupe choice to the Kia Sonet as effectively whereas additionally providing a stronger turbo-petrol unit. That mentioned, the Fronx additionally falls brief on the identical parameters because the Brezza when in comparison with the Kia SUV, with out the benefit of the additional cabin area both.

Renault Kiger/Nissan Magnite: BUY For Affordability, Decent Features, And Petrol Powertrains

The Renault Kiger and Nissan Magnite are essentially the most reasonably priced sub-4m SUVs in the marketplace in the present day, whereas packing comparable cabin area and a few premium options like their costlier rivals. These embrace cruise management, 8-inch digital driver’s show, and even a 360-degree digicam (Nissan Magnite solely). The two petrol-only SUVs get a selection of naturally aspirated and turbocharged engines together with each guide and computerized choices for every.

Mahindra XUV300: BUY For Space And A Diesel Engine Option

Mahindra XUV300

Since 2019, the Mahindra XUV300 has been a beneficial selection for consumers searching for a sub-4m SUV with a diesel engine. It acquired many segment-leading options from the time it was launched and remains to be one of many few fashions in its phase to supply a selection of a diesel powertrain. It’s necessary to notice that the facelifted Mahindra XUV300 is because of debut quickly and is anticipated to be launched in 2024. So, until you’re getting an important take care of massive reductions on the outgoing XUV300, we’d suggest you anticipate the brand new one to reach.

2024 Kia Sonet: HOLD For Sharper Looks, More Features And A Range Of Powertrains

2024 Kia Sonet

The Kia Sonet was at all times a well-rounded providing ever since its market introduction in 2020. With the facelift, the carmaker has solely sweetened the deal by giving it a a lot sharper design together with an excellent longer record of options. These embrace the ten.25-inch digital driver’s show, a 360-degree digicam, 4-way powered driver seat and ADAS. While it is going to proceed to be supplied with each petrol and diesel engines as earlier than, Kia has additionally determined to convey again the diesel-manual combo which was changed with the diesel-iMT (guide with out the clutch pedal) possibility.

Bollinger B1 And B2: Everything We Know So Far

The Bollinger B1 was much more than a concept. It promised a horsepower of 614 ponies and was set to enter the electric market in 2022. However, Bollinger canceled both the Bollinger B1 SUV and Bollinger B2 truck, leaving a gap in the electric vehicle world.

Now, Bollinger Motors has announced that it plans to bring back the two concept models at an undetermined release date. These models were unprecedented because they proved that power and off-roading navigation could coexist with a 100-percent electric motor. The Bollinger also had a unique style with a vintage military feel that is usually associated with gas-guzzlers.

The relaunch of the Bollinger models comes at a prime time, as more utilitarian-style electric SUVs are scheduled to make a debut.

The Bollinger B1 And B2 Are Making A Comeback

Bollinger B1
Bollinger

The Bollinger B1 was first introduced in 2017 with an anticipated acceleration rate of 4.5 seconds to 60 MPH. It was designed to be adaptable and appeal to a wider range of potential customers. The Bollinger B2, on the other hand, had a pickup truck persona.

Bollinger B1 and B2 Specs

Bollinger B1 SUV

Bollinger B2 Truck

Layout

Dual electric motors

Dual electric motors

Horsepower

614 horsepower

614 horsepower

Torque

668 pound-feet

668 pound-feet

Range

200 miles

200 miles

0-60 MPH

4.5 seconds

4.5 seconds

Top Speed

100 MPH

100 MPH

Source: Bollinger (estimated values from 2022)

The Bollinger SUV and truck plans may focus more on commercial work vehicles rather than consumers. The company will outsource engineering work for the B1 and B2 models.

“The B1 team is starting right now,” said Robert Bollinger, founder of Bollinger Motors. “We got to a pretty good point with the bodywork and stamping before we paused. We’re bringing all that back, and the work is continuing.”

A Unique Construction Sets The Models Apart By Linking Vintage and Modern

Bollinger
Bollinger

Unlike other EV start-ups that focus on abstract features and clean lines, the Bollinger embraces a simpler vintage aesthetic. It doesn’t have swanky technology and mega touchscreen displays. It’s a no-frills car that appeals to classic car lovers, off-road adventurers, and environment enthusiasts. The Bollinger brand is full of contradictions, but it oddly works.

Robert Bollinger, the head of Bollinger Motors, initially aimed to revolutionize the commercial truck market. However, the Bollinger B1, with its unique design, garnered a lot of attention from consumers. In just five months, 10,000 vehicle reservations piled up for the Bollinger SUV.

While other manufacturers have also started making vintage electric off-roaders, Bollinger possesses a niche market and expertise in establishing efficient work vehicles, which gives it an advantage.

With A Steep $125,000 Price Tag, The Bollinger Models Are More Costly Than The Competition

Bollinger B1 side view
Bollinger

The Bollinger B1 and B2 models were anticipated to enter the electric vehicle market with a starting price of $125,000, which is higher than the competition. For example, the Munro MK_1 is expected to start at around $60,000, and the Volkswagen Scout is rumored to start at $40,000. The Mercedes EQG concept comes closest in price at $150,000.

Having a range of 200 miles may not be enough to impress customers anymore, as electric vehicle technology has advanced rapidly. SUVs like the Fisker Ocean Extreme exceed 350 miles in range, setting a high benchmark for battery longevity.

Despite competition from other manufacturers, Bollinger Motors has a unique focus on commercial work vehicles and applies the same principles to consumer vehicles. This makes its vehicles more practical for off-roading and sets it apart from other automakers.

We’ll Have To Wait And Watch What Happens

It is too soon to tell whether Bollinger will succeed with its pricing strategy or if other manufacturers will face challenges when the B1 and B2 models are released. While there is no clear timeline for production, Bollinger fans can look forward to the eventual release of these electric utility vehicles.
